Welcome to St Andrew's Nursery.
We have a large Nursery Unit offering a range of flexible places for 3 and 4 year old children. These include free 15 hour morning or afternoon places, as well as 30 hour free childcare for eligible families. 30 hour childcare is equivalent to a full time Nursery place (term time only).
We provide excellent professional education, support and care through a play-based, child-centred approach to learning. We follow the Early Years Foundation Stage curriculum supported by Development Matters.

St Andrew’s School first opened in 1865 with 95 pupils. The original building now holds six Key Stage 2 classes. An extension was opened in 2002 which houses a library as well as a Year 5/6 class. Three Key Stage 1 classrooms are in an early 20th century building. A fourth infant classroom was added to this building in 2000 and a fifth in 2005 and our two Reception groups work here. The nursery (Foundation 1) was built and opened in 1976. The hall, dining room, kitchens, ICT suite and administrative rooms are found in a fourth building. Surprisingly, children find their way round these buildings more quickly than you would expect!
Over half of the children at St Andrew’s live in the small catchment area immediately surrounding the school.
